Now that we got through that, here are my problems:

1) as you saw above, the system speaker only makes a sound when I have no memory installed. When memory is installed and at all other times, speaker is silent.

2) When I have video card installed and connect via DVI to monitor, I get message that PCI-E power plug needs to be connected to video card. It was an I reconnected several times with no changes.

3) When I had the above issues, I swapped out my new PSU with one that I can trust as working. After swapping all of the cables and the PSU unit, there was no change: the system still started up and brought me to the BIOS window, but there were no beeps from the speaker.

4) BIOS is not detecting either SSD which are connected to SATA1 and SATA2 respectively. There is no SATA0. I connected a optical disk drive to SATA3. It worked for a few reboots while I was troubleshooting but now the optical drive turns on for a few seconds then turns off. However if I open the optical drive to remove the disk it still does this. Will not automatically go to Windows installation anymore. Even if it did, I'm not detecting any SSDs.

5) For a while, the system fan wasn't turning on but CPU fan was. When the optical drive stopped working, the system fan suddenly started working.

6) The HDD LED flashes once when I turn the system on then does not light up again.

7) Currently, when I boot up with everything attachwd except the SSDs, it ignores the Windows 8 installation disk and brings me right to the BIOs. The fans are spinning, there are no sounds from the speaker and the optical drive is on. I've put aside the new PSU and am using the 650W which I know is working from my other build.

Please help. This may be an RMA issue but I have done a lot to try to solve it. It's not the PSU because i used two. It could be the RAM, the CPU, the mobo, the SSDs, and/or the video card but these are all new/unused and I can't figure it out.
